"We create the Universe as much as it creates us." - Stephen Hawking & Thomas Hertog How did the Universe begin? Will it ever end? The cosmos and Man's place in it have fascinated humans for thousands of years. These mind-bending cosmic questions keep scientists awake at night, but also fuel the imagination and fantasy of artists. This unique book combines the insights of scientists and visual artists, offering a magnificent overview of the visualisation of the Universe from the Neolithic to the present. In addition, dozens of stunning modern and contemporary artworks engage in a dialogue with the Big Bang theory in its various forms. Professor Georges Lemaitre formulated his revolutionary theory about the origin of the Universe in 1931 at the University of Leuven. In 2021, our ideas about this Big Bang and the cosmos as a whole are still evolving. Our astonishment and desire to visualise what we are unable to comprehend fully, however, remain unchanged. With enlightening contributions from Barbara Baert, Abdelkader Benali, Thomas Hertog, Hannah Redler Hawes, Jan Van der Stock, Annelies Vogels, and others.

Marking the 50th anniversary of the acclaimed Sarah Campbell Blaffer Foundation, this commemorative book presents masterpieces from the foundation's collection. The works span more than 400 years, from the 16th through the early 20th century, and feature a range of media including paintings, prints, and printed books. After a comprehensive introduction to the foundation and its collection, essays by eight scholars present new scholarship on key works. The featured objects include an image of the Madonna and Child by the Florentine painter Giuliano Bugiardini; Richard Wilson's iconic 18th-century composition The White Monk; printed materials in Venice that bridged Jewish and Christian cultures; and portraits by Paolo Veronese, Simon Vouet, and others. With more than 200 illustrations, this beautiful publication is a rich survey as well as a timely celebration of this exceptional collection. Distributed for the Sarah Campbell Blaffer Foundation and the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ston
